Each tenant's limits are resolved at request time from the quota service, so plugins must never cache quota values for longer than the `QUOTA_TTL_SECONDS` setting allows (default 30). Exceeding a quota returns a 429 with a `Retry-After` header your plugin must honor. To query remaining quota programmatically, your plugin authenticates to the quota service using a credential defined in its environment file. Add the following line immediately after QUOTA_SERVICE_URL:

env line for fafof-fahag: LEDGER_TOKEN5=f8790

Ticket: DNS drift — Fernlock resolver inconsistency

The Fernlock gateway intermittently fails to resolve internal service names, but only on two of six prod nodes. Investigation shows those nodes carry an older resolver configuration with a shorter cache TTL and a stale search domain, diverging from the fleet baseline. No change record exists for the divergence. The expected baseline configuration is as follows.

settings of yagag-kahop:
FENWYN_PIN=6385
FENWYN_METRICS_HOST=metrics.fenwyn.nelvrolabs.corp
FENWYN_LOG_LEVEL=error
FENWYN_TENANT=casok

## Further Reading

The Quillgate proctoring queue is priority-ordered; exam-start events preempt everything else. Retries are capped at three — after that, sessions land in the dead-letter table and an invigilator override is required. Don't touch the visibility timeout without reading the scheduler notes; it's tuned against webcam-check latency. Queue depth alarms fire at 500. Consumer scaling is manual for now, by design. Architecture decisions, failure modes, and the replay procedure are documented on the internal wiki here:

operations page: https://jira.qorvelsys.internal/browse/pages/browse/pages

Internal Memo — Budget Request

To the sales leads: Operations has submitted a budget request to fund two additional demo kits for the Vellane product line and travel support for the Ashgrove territory push. Finance expects a decision within two weeks. No changes to current spending limits until then; log any urgent needs with your regional coordinator. Background on the request's purpose appears below.

board note of fahaf-fadug: Gilixax Logistics is in early talks to buy Praiusax Partners for about $8.1 million. The Pramir launch date is September 23, and nothing goes to the press before then.